**Q: How do snapshot tests work for our UI components?**

Every component in the Larkspur design system has a stored snapshot of its rendered output. When you change a component, the test runner compares the new render against the snapshot and flags differences. Review diffs carefully before updating snapshots — blind updates hide regressions. Full setup steps and review guidelines live on the internal page below.

runbook for badug-kadup: https://confluence.zemvarlabs.internal/projects/browse/display/projects/bd1b

Subject: Transcoding farm — new owner

Team,

Effective Monday, responsibility for the Kestrelworks transcoding farm changes hands. This covers the encode workers, the preset library, and the nightly capacity report. Runbooks are in the usual wiki space; read them before your first on-call shift. Route all questions about job failures, codec presets, or scaling requests to the new owner, named below.

account owner for bawip-tahag: Raleth Quenok

Subject: Ledger boxes heading your way

Hi dispatch,

Quick heads-up for the folks at the Greystone archive site: six boxes of old paper ledgers from the Farrowmill office are going out on Thursday's van. They're sealed, labelled, and stacked by the loading door already. Manifest copy is taped to box one. Should be an easy run. When the courier arrives to collect, pass along this instruction:

drop instructions, bawep-tahaf: the praix belion courier leaves the lamix holdor tamwyn kasix tamael ulays wenath wenox ledger at gate 6249 under passcode 007677

# Hey reviewer — this is the env for Skimmerly's autocomplete service.
# Context: the suggest index was painfully slow, so we moved it to an
# in-memory trie with a warm-start snapshot. Relevant knobs:
#   INDEX_SNAPSHOT_PATH — where warm-start data lives (read-only mount)
#   INDEX_REBUILD_CRON — nightly full rebuild, don't make it more frequent
#   SUGGEST_MAX_RESULTS — capped at 10, on purpose
# Snapshots are encrypted at rest; nothing sensitive is logged.
# The snapshot encryption secret is set on the next line.

sealed setting: ARCHIVE_KEY3=8d0